How AI decides which businesses to recommend

When someone asks an AI assistant for “the best plumber near me” or “a good dentist in Austin,” the AI pulls from live web search, your Google Business Profile, review sites, and trusted directories. It favors businesses that are verified, consistently listed, well-reviewed, and clearly described. If your signals are incomplete or contradictory, AI skips you and names a competitor instead.

6 ways to get your business to show up in AI

1. Complete and verify your Google Business Profile

This is the single biggest signal for local AI recommendations. Fill in your primary category, services, hours, photos, and a keyword-clear description, and make sure the profile is verified.

2. Make your name, address & phone identical everywhere

AI cross-checks your details across directories. Inconsistent NAP (name, address, phone) makes you look untrustworthy. Standardize it on Google, Yelp, Apple Maps, Bing, Facebook, and your industry directories.

3. Earn recent, genuine reviews

Volume and recency of reviews are a strong trust signal AI leans on. Ask happy customers to review you, and respond to every review professionally.

4. Build citations on the directories that matter

Being listed consistently across the right directories (general, industry-specific, local, and data aggregators) tells AI you're a real, established business.

5. Publish content that answers buyer questions

AI quotes pages that give a direct, self-contained answer. Write clear pages that answer the exact questions your customers ask, with the answer up top and a simple structure.

Why isn't my business showing up in ChatGPT or Google AI Overviews?

Usually because AI can't find consistent, trustworthy signals about you. Common gaps: an incomplete or unverified Google Business Profile, inconsistent listings across directories, few recent reviews, or thin website content that doesn't answer buyer questions. Fix those signals and your odds of being named climb.

Is showing up in AI different from regular SEO?

It overlaps but isn't the same. Traditional SEO targets the ten blue links. AI visibility (AEO, or Answer Engine Optimization) is about being named and linked inside the AI answer itself, which leans heavily on your local presence, reviews, citations, and clearly structured, quotable content.
